Starting your repair and service of the steering wheel requires the removal of the driver
Air Bag module first. Start by disconnecting the steering wheel switch electrical connector from the
Clock Spring and conductively separate the wiring from its retainers while placing wires aside. The steering wheel bolt needs removal while users must apply 40 Nm (30 lb-ft) torque when reinstalling it. When using the Steering Wheel Puller to remove the steering wheel avoid both the wires and connector of the steering wheel switch. The project requires taping down the center rotor of the Clock Spring to stop its rotating motion. The installation process ends when performing the opposite steps used during removal.
